Digital Force & Torque Gauges Series 5 premium digital force gauges feature a blazingly fast sampling rate of 7,000 Hz and ±0.1% accuracy, producing reliable, accurate results even in quick-action testing. Additional advanced features such as averaging mode, external trigger mode, pass- word protection, and data memory for 1,000 readings make this flexible gauge series ideal for a wide range ■ Communication with external devices Full ASCII command set, allowing for communication with a PC, PLC, or other device through USB or RS-232. Mitutoyo and analog outputs also included. ■ Averaging / external...

Digital Force & Torque Gauges Series 3 basic digital force gauges feature a sampling rate of 2,000 Hz and ±0.3% accuracy, ideal for numer- ous applications in virtually every industry. Set point indicators with outputs are useful for visual pass/fail testing, while an analog load bar provides graphical representation of applied load. Ultra-compact, revers- ible housing allows for flexibility in many mounting configurations with space constraints. Individual readings may be output to a PC through High, low, and in-range indicators are displayed ac- cording to programmed upper and lower set points....

Digital Force & Torque Gauges Series TT03 digital torque gauges are designed for clockwise and counter-clockwise torque test- ing applications in virtually every industry with capacities from 10 ozFin to 100 IbFin (7 to 1,150 Ncm). A dedicated remote torque sensor with Jacobs chuck can be used to grip a sample, bit, or fixture. The gauges' rugged aluminum housing allows for hand-held use or test stand mounting for more sophisticated testing requirements. ■ Rugged, compact design Indicator and remote sensor with Jacobs chuck. Can be hand-held or mounted to a test stand. Individual readings may...

Digital Force & Torque Gauges Series TT01 closure torque testers present an accu- rate, value priced solution for closure manufacturers, bottlers, and food and beverage companies. The tester features solid aluminum construction for many years of service in many environments. Adjustable posts grip a broad range of container shapes and sizes, while sets of optional jaws are available as an alternative gripping methods. Peak torque readings are always shown on the large, backlit graphic display. ■ USB, RS-232, Mitutoyo, and analog outputs 1,000-point data memory with statistics (min, max, mean,...

<4Í> ^'u9 ^ Test™ Indicators & Sensors Measure force and torque with interchangeable indicators and remote sensors Models 5i and 3i force / torque indicators are designed for use with Mark-10's Plug & Test™ remote force and torque sensors. All cali- bration and configuration data is saved within the sensors' smart connectors - not the indicator - allowing for true interchangeability. Each sensor series is available in a range of capacities, from 0.25 to 10,000 IbF (1 N to 50 kN) full scale and from 10 ozFin to 5,000 IbFin (7 Ncm to 550 Nm) full scale. Sensor details are provided on the fol- lowing...

Plug & Test™ Indicators & Sensors Torque Sensors Universal torque sensors, fixed chuck Measure bidirectional torque for a wide variety of ap- plications. Contain a chuck for up to 1/2" diameter samples. Sensors can be used as hand held devices or mounted to a torque test stand. Capacities available from 10 ozFin to 100 IbFin [7 to 1,150 Ncm] Universal torque sensors, interchangeable A great solution for general bidirectional torque testing applications with several different sample sizes. Three nterchangeable chuck capacities and bit holder are available. The R51 has super overload protection...
